Every contest result on record for Dan Meece, 8 in all. Won by names the winner of the division Dan Meece competed in, and shows a dash where that winner cannot be pinned to one person in the database.

YearContestDivisionPlaceWon by
2011 Emerald Cup Other Divisions #4 Osiris Wa
2010 Masters Nationals Other Divisions #8 Chris Filippelli
2009 Masters Nationals Other Divisions #3 Michael Brown
2008 Masters Nationals Other Divisions #7 Bill Scarnaty
2007 Masters Nationals Other Divisions #7 Bill Scarnaty
2006 Emerald Cup Other Divisions #4 Quin Kessler
2005 Emerald Cup Other Divisions #3 Robert Rogers
2004 Emerald Cup Other Divisions #12 Osiris Wa
